Liberia's national football team has been forced to cancel an upcoming friendly match against Major League Soccer's Minnesota United due to U.S. visa denials. The Liberian Ministry of Sports announced the cancellation on Wednesday, stating that visa applications for several team members and the official delegation were rejected.

According to the ministry's statement on Facebook, the visa denials made it impossible for Liberia to field the necessary delegation and meet the contractual obligations for the match, which was scheduled for July 26. The cancellation comes amid heightened scrutiny of U.S. visa policies.

Minnesota United confirmed the match's cancellation without providing a specific reason. The club expressed disappointment, stating, "While we were looking forward to welcoming the Liberia National Team and celebrating the strong ties between Minnesotaโ€™s Liberian community and our club, circumstances outside of our control have made it necessary to cancel the match."

The situation highlights potential challenges for international teams seeking to travel to the United States, particularly in the context of restrictive visa policies. This cancellation follows a World Cup period where numerous supporters reportedly faced difficulties gaining entry into the United States.
